Stephen Powers
Stock Analyst at Deutsche Bank
(1.13)
# 3,819
Out of 5,122 analysts
89
Total ratings
37.04%
Success rate
-8.94%
Average return
Main Sectors:
Stocks Rated by Stephen Powers
|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
|---|---|---|---|---|---|---|---|
| MKC McCormick & Company | Maintains: Hold | $79 → $71 | $68.48 | +3.68% | 2 | Oct 8, 2025 | |
| MKC.V McCormick & Company | Maintains: Hold | $79 → $71 | $68.12 | +4.23% | 2 | Oct 8, 2025 | |
| PRMB Primo Brands | Maintains: Buy | $38 → $40 | $16.43 | +143.46% | 1 | Feb 28, 2025 | |
| MDLZ Mondelez International | Maintains: Hold | $67 → $62 | $54.81 | +13.12% | 4 | Jan 22, 2025 | |
| CLX The Clorox Company | Maintains: Hold | $161 → $164 | $100.81 | +62.68% | 4 | Dec 12, 2024 | |
| FRPT Freshpet | Maintains: Buy | $161 → $163 | $60.13 | +171.08% | 2 | Nov 5, 2024 | |
| KHC The Kraft Heinz Company | Downgrades: Hold | $39 → $35 | $24.43 | +43.27% | 4 | Oct 31, 2024 | |
| CAG Conagra Brands | Maintains: Hold | $38 → $36 | $17.43 | +106.54% | 2 | Jun 29, 2023 | |
| BRCC BRC Inc. | Initiates: Hold | $19 | $1.13 | +1,581.42% | 1 | Mar 31, 2022 | |
| GIS General Mills | Maintains: Buy | $71 → $73 | $46.67 | +56.42% | 1 | Mar 24, 2022 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$159 → $158 | $144.05 | +9.68% | 8 | Apr 21, 2021 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$32 → $33 | $28.15 | +17.23% | 1 | Apr 21, 2021 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$23 → $24 | $3.78 | +534.92% | 6 | Apr 21, 2021 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$176 → $185 | $140.13 | +32.02% | 11 | Jul 2,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$61 → $64 | $26.33 | +143.07% | 4 | Jun 10,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$46 → $43 | $91.60 | -53.06% | 2 | Apr 29,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$145 → $143 | $144.16 | -0.80% | 5 | Mar 12,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Hold | $126 → $132 | $101.57 | +29.96% | 9 | Jan 24, 2020 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Hold | n/a | $46.80 | - | 5 | Feb 13, 2019 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Downgrades: Hold | n/a | $46.50 | - | 5 | Feb 13, 2019 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Upgrades: Buy | n/a | $77.41 | - | 3 | Mar 5, 2018 | |
| X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Neutral | $72 → $68 | $57.77 | +17.71% | 7 | Oct 27, 2017 |
McCormick & Company
Oct 8, 2025
Maintains: Hold
Price Target: $79 → $71
Current: $68.48
Upside: +3.68%
McCormick & Company
Oct 8, 2025
Maintains: Hold
Price Target: $79 → $71
Current: $68.12
Upside: +4.23%
Primo Brands
Feb 28, 2025
Maintains: Buy
Price Target: $38 → $40
Current: $16.43
Upside: +143.46%
Mondelez International
Jan 22, 2025
Maintains: Hold
Price Target: $67 → $62
Current: $54.81
Upside: +13.12%
The Clorox Company
Dec 12, 2024
Maintains: Hold
Price Target: $161 → $164
Current: $100.81
Upside: +62.68%
Freshpet
Nov 5, 2024
Maintains: Buy
Price Target: $161 → $163
Current: $60.13
Upside: +171.08%
The Kraft Heinz Company
Oct 31, 2024
Downgrades: Hold
Price Target: $39 → $35
Current: $24.43
Upside: +43.27%
Conagra Brands
Jun 29, 2023
Maintains: Hold
Price Target: $38 → $36
Current: $17.43
Upside: +106.54%
BRC Inc.
Mar 31, 2022
Initiates: Hold
Price Target: $19
Current: $1.13
Upside: +1,581.42%
General Mills
Mar 24, 2022
Maintains: Buy
Price Target: $71 → $73
Current: $46.67
Upside: +56.42%
Apr 21, 2021
Maintains: Buy
Price Target: $159 → $158
Current: $144.05
Upside: +9.68%
Apr 21, 2021
Maintains: Hold
Price Target: $32 → $33
Current: $28.15
Upside: +17.23%
Apr 21, 2021
Maintains: Hold
Price Target: $23 → $24
Current: $3.78
Upside: +534.92%
Jul 2, 2020
Maintains: Hold
Price Target: $176 → $185
Current: $140.13
Upside: +32.02%
Jun 10, 2020
Maintains: Hold
Price Target: $61 → $64
Current: $26.33
Upside: +143.07%
Apr 29, 2020
Maintains: Neutral
Price Target: $46 → $43
Current: $91.60
Upside: -53.06%
Mar 12, 2020
Maintains: Hold
Price Target: $145 → $143
Current: $144.16
Upside: -0.80%
Jan 24, 2020
Maintains: Hold
Price Target: $126 → $132
Current: $101.57
Upside: +29.96%
Feb 13, 2019
Downgrades: Hold
Price Target: n/a
Current: $46.80
Upside: -
Feb 13, 2019
Downgrades: Hold
Price Target: n/a
Current: $46.50
Upside: -
Mar 5, 2018
Upgrades: Buy
Price Target: n/a
Current: $77.41
Upside: -
Oct 27, 2017
Maintains: Neutral
Price Target: $72 → $68
Current: $57.77
Upside: +17.71%